NAICS Code 811121-24 Description (8-Digit)

Canopies Truck Repair & Service is a specialized industry that focuses on repairing and maintaining the canopies of trucks. This industry involves a range of services that are aimed at ensuring that the canopies of trucks are in good condition and functioning properly. Canopies Truck Repair & Service companies are responsible for repairing and replacing damaged canopies, as well as providing regular maintenance services to ensure that the canopies are in good working order.

History

A concise historical narrative of NAICS Code 811121-24 covering global milestones and recent developments within the United States.

  • The Canopies Truck Repair & Service industry has a long history of providing repair and maintenance services for commercial trucks. The industry has evolved over time, with key milestones including the development of specialized equipment and tools for repairing and maintaining truck canopies, as well as advancements in materials used for canopies. In recent years, the industry has also seen an increase in demand for customization services, such as the installation of specialized lighting and other accessories. In the United States, the industry has been impacted by changes in regulations related to truck safety and emissions, as well as shifts in the overall economy and transportation industry. Despite these challenges, the industry has remained resilient and continues to provide essential services to the trucking industry.
